Hi, and welcome to the Quillpress on-call rotation. The markdown rendering pipeline runs in three stages: parse, sanitize, and render-to-cache. Most pages you'll see involve the sanitizer rejecting malformed embeds, which is safe to retry once. Never bypass sanitization, even under pressure — it exists for good reasons. Runbooks, stage diagrams, and the retry procedure are all collected on the internal page below.

dashboard of fajog-bajog = https://jenkins.tolvaqcorp.example/settings/merge_requests/spaces/job/5a4ad928065606e7

/*
 * DNS_RETRY_BUDGET_MS
 *
 * Welcome aboard! Quick context: the Pinebarrow cluster's internal
 * resolver occasionally times out under load, so we retry lookups
 * within this budget instead of failing fast. Don't lower it without
 * checking the Ospry dashboard first — flakiness spikes on Mondays.
 * Value was last tuned against this build:
 */

session token of tajef-bageg = htk21_5d90d574934f3ccae6437

**Break-glass: Feedcheck validator.** Feedcheck validates podcast feeds before publish. If the validator wedges and blocks all releases, break-glass access lets you bypass validation for one deploy. Use sparingly; every bypass is audited and reviewed at the next sync. Procedure: open the ops console on the Darrow box, select "emergency bypass," confirm twice. The bypass prompt requires the recovery passphrase, which follows below.

vault phrase of bagaf-kajeg = jorath-feniel-briir-siliel-ralix